
Oddington - Pear Tree Cottage, Price: £ from £ 1124.00 - Sleeps: 8
Pear Tree Cottage is perfect for anyone looking for a luxurious stay in the Cotswolds. Located in the delightful village of Oddington, only five minut...
Dog Free Baby Welcome Enclosed Garden Log Burner/Open Fire On Site Parking Wifi Pub Nearby Children Welcome Hamper Table Tennis Walking